How Our Floodwater Removal Service Works
At our company, we understand the importance of a proper process with floodwater removal. That’s why we’ve developed a step-by-step approach that ensures your property is thoroughly cleaned and restored. From initial inspection to final restoration, we’ll be with you every step of the way.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our team will arrive at your property to assess the extent of the damage. We’ll identify the source of the flooding and find out the best course of action to restore your home. No hidden fees or surprises.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use industrial-strength pumps and vacuums to remove standing water from your home, including carpets, upholstery, and other porous materials. Leaving your home dry and safe.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your home, removing moisture and preventing further damage. Ensuring your home is safe for habitation.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We’ll thoroughly clean and sanitize your home, including walls, floors, and surfaces, to remove any remaining bacteria, mold, or mildew. Leaving your home fresh and clean.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
We’ll work with you and your insurance company to restore your home to its original condition. This may include repairs to walls, floors, and ceilings, as well as replacement of damaged materials. Restoring your home to its former glory.

Floodwater Removal Cost in Wellston, OK
The cost of floodwater removal in Wellston, OK,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and other local conditions. These estimates are based on the average cost of services in the area and can range from: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$300 – $1,500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Restoration and Reconstruction |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ials needed, labor costs |
| Specialized Equipment and Labor | $500 – $2,000 | Type of equipment needed, labor costs |
| Free Estimates and On-Site Assessments | $0 – $100 | No-cost estimates vary depending on location and service requirements |
Keep in mind that these estimates are based on the average cost of services in the area and can vary depending on the specific circumstances of your case. We’ll provide a more accurate estimate after an on-site assessment. No hidden fees or surprises.
